Surah Al-Kafirun, the 109th chapter of the Quran, is a powerful testament to the importance of respecting differences. This short but profound chapter, revealed in Mecca during a time of intense conflict between Muslims and polytheists, offers a clear and concise message of tolerance and understanding. It emphasizes the distinct nature of faith and the need to acknowledge and respect the beliefs of others, even when they differ from our own.

The Essence of Al-Kafirun: A Clear Distinction

The core message of Surah Al-Kafirun revolves around the concept of "tawhid," the belief in the oneness of God. The verses clearly distinguish between the worship of Allah, the one true God, and the worship of idols or other deities. The surah begins with a declaration of faith: "Say, 'O disbelievers, I do not worship what you worship.'" This statement establishes a clear boundary between the believer and the disbeliever, emphasizing the distinct nature of their respective beliefs.

The Importance of Respecting Differences

The surah goes on to emphasize the importance of respecting these differences. It states, "And you do not worship what I worship." This simple yet profound statement acknowledges the right of others to hold their own beliefs, even if they differ from our own. It teaches us to accept and respect the diversity of faith and to refrain from imposing our beliefs on others.

The Path to Harmony: Tolerance and Understanding

Surah Al-Kafirun teaches us that true harmony lies in tolerance and understanding. It encourages us to engage in respectful dialogue and to avoid conflict based on religious differences. The surah concludes with a powerful message of peace: "To you your religion, and to me my religion." This statement underscores the importance of respecting the right of each individual to practice their own faith without interference.
